Tampa Bay Buccaneers and QB Baker Mayfield in stalled contract talks

The Tampa Bay Buccaneers and quarterback Baker Mayfield have made no progress on a new contract as the offseason advances. According to ESPN commentator Jeremy Fowler, neither side is “sweating” the negotiations, noting that both parties have five weeks before training camp to resolve the issue. Former NFL general manager Tom Telesco said the likely salary will be north of $50 million per year, possibly around $53 million, comparable to other top quarterbacks. Mayfield’s current deal is $33 million APY and his deadline to reach an agreement is the start of training camp on July 28.
